En cours

Small c++ application for Linux

We need a very small and simple c++ service for Linux with serial communication support.

The application must be a prototype, that we ourself can complete. So it just needs to contain basic functionality, this is not a complete application.

These are the requirements:

- Must be an eclipse cpp project (c++) called myapp

- Target platform is Ubuntu [url removed, login to view] 32 bit

- Must start as a service with this command line "service myapp start"

- Must stop as a service with this command line "service myapp stop"

- Must restart as a service with this command line "service myapp restart"

- Four functions must be available in a class for serial communication:

open(string port, baudrate, databits, stopbits, parity, handshake) (target mode is 9600, 8, 1, n, no handshake)

write(char* txt) - writes the txt string to the port

char* read(int timeoutMs) - reads whatever is present until timeout, return null if nothing is read

close() - closes the port and frees any resources

- All source files/scripts needed for above must be developed.

These are the complete requirements, no more is needed and we will complete the project ourself, but ofcourse the above should work 100%. We estimate it will take approximately 2 hours for an experienced c++/linux programmer.

We need this as soon as possible.

Compétences : Programmation C++, Linux

Voir plus : ubuntu service, ubuntu programming, string functions cpp, string cpp, string cplusplus, service prototype, serial programming, serial port programming, programming cpp, programming scripts, programming resources, programming ubuntu, linux serial port programming, eclipse programming, string programming, programming string functions, programming string, programming char, cpp string, cpp programming, cpp int string, cplusplus string, command line programming, char programming, application functionality

Concernant l'employeur :
( 2 commentaires ) Randers, Denmark

N° du projet : #1083484

Décerné à :


Very easy job.

30 $ USD en 0 jours
(1 Commentaire)

2 freelance ont fait une offre moyenne de 40 $ pour ce travail


please check your PM Box

50 $ USD en 1 jour
(142 Commentaires)